Garmin Fishfinder 160 blue
Review
The Fishfinder Blue Series®
is designed for offshore fishing enthusiasts.
The Fishfinder 160 Blue operates at dual
frequencies. With the 50/200 kHz transducer,
you can reach greater depths and get a wider
viewing area. And you will see those returns
on a crisp, four-level grayscale screen
for excellent separation and contrast. This
seaworthy fishfinder is rugged and waterproof.
But despite its tough exterior, it's extremely
easy to operate, with features like a convenient
adjustment bar that gives you access to
the most commonly used fishing settings.
The Fishfinder 160 Blue boasts increased
power and dual frequency of 50/200 kHz,
which makes it ideal for the saltwater environment.
Improved screen contrast and increased image
update rate also set it apart from its freshwater
counterpart.
From the outside, the Fishfinder 160 Blue
will resemble the freshwater versions, with
the size of the waterproof case and the
keypad configuration remaining the same.
The real changes can be found on the inside
with increased power and upgraded displays.
The Fishfinder 160 Blue brings 4000 watts
power, peak-to-peak (500 RMS) and 160 x
160 pixels. The Fishfinder 160 Blue will
also come standard with speed and temperature
sensors.
